📐 About this role

We're looking for a senior GTM sourcer to join our fast-growing talent acquisition team.

🦸🏻‍♀️ Your respon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ute all outbound and inbound sourcing and hiring efforts in partnership with our industry GTM recruiters and Sales, Customer Success, Delivery, and Solution Architect teams.

  • Partner with recruiters, hiring managers and other cross-functional teams to lead efforts both outbound and inbound recruiting strategies for various GTM roles

  • Develop and maintain a rich pipeline of top technical talent through various sourcing strategies which may include industry events

  • Regularly develop market and talent maps and share total addressable market insights to inform recruitment strategies

  • Use data insights to inform sourcing strategies and partner with recruiters and hiring managers to identify bottlenecks and areas for improvement in the overall candidate hiring life-cycle

  • Conduct screening, facilitate first-round candidate interviews, and conduct reference checks

  • Implement and build scalable sourcing process for the teams you support

  • Utilize advanced sourcing tools such as Gem, LinkedIn, and others to identify and engage with potential candidates, ensuring a wide and effective reach.

  • Leverage reporting tools to track sourcing metrics and analyze data to improve recruitment strategies and outcomes.

⭐️ Is this you?

  • 4 + years of GTM sourcing experience, within a fast-paced and dynamic environment.

  • Strong familiarity with sourcing tools such as Gem, LinkedIn and other sourcing-relevant platforms.

  • Experience working with a variety of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S)

  • Demonstrated ability to optimize recruitment processes, manage multiple projects simultaneously, and meet tight deadlines.

  • Creative thinking skills with a proven ability to develop innovative solutions and leverage technology to streamline and automate recruitment tasks.

  • Experience using analytics and reporting tools to track sourcing metrics and analyze data to refine and improve recruitment strategies.

  • Excellent communication abilities with a knack for effective collaboration across a diverse range of stakeholders.

  • Ability to manage sensitive and confidential information with discretion.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
